M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GInformal Complaint Processing

INFORMAL COMPLAINT

• May be brought to the attention of any member of the chain of command at the lowest level of command where a remedy or resolution is possible, or the EOL or EOA at that level

• Commander at the lower level will have 30 calendar days (or through the following drill weekend) to resolve the complaint. If unresolved after 30 calendar days, or through the next drill: Complainant may withdraw complaint or it can become formal

• Regardless of the level at which an informal complaint is filed, the commander at that level shall have 30 calendar days or through the next drill period to resolve the complaint to the satisfaction of the complainant

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GInformal Complaint Processing

NOTIFICATION PROCEDURES

• Complaint MUST be filed 180 days from the date of alleged discrimination

• Chain of command will be the primary channel for resolving discrimination complaints, Individuals will be encouraged to use command channels for redress of grievances

• Allegations of discrimination will be referred for processing by the lowest command level

• EO personnel will provide appropriate feedback to the complainant on the status of his/her complaint

• File with any member of the chain of command at the lowest level of the command where remedy or resolution is possible, or the EOL or EOA. If unresolved at one level, and forwarded to the next level, the complainant will be provided a copy of the inquiry and will have 30 days to file a appeal with the next higher level of command

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GFormal Complaint Processing

ADDITIONAL NOTES

• Disciplinary action against the individual responsible for substantiated discrimination is within the discretion of the commander or supervisor and not the right of the complainant to demand as part of a resolution. Punitive action may be appropriate and should be considered by the command or supervisor as a means of maintaining good order and discipline; it does nothing in terms to restoring any benefits or privileges lost by complainants as a results of the discrimination

• Anonymous complaints alleged discrimination received by State or NGB Officials will not be processed under regulation

• Any person who knowingly submits a false equal opportunity complaint (a complaint containing information of allegations that the complainant knew to be false) may be subject to judicial or non-judicial punishment

Page 30: Military  EO Compliant Processing

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

30

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GDEPLOYED - Formal Complaint Processing

NOTIFICATION PROCEDURES

• Complaint must be filed within 60 calendar days from the date the alleged incident DA Form 7279 http://www.armyg1.army.mil/eo/docs/a7279_r.pdf

• Referred to appropriate commander within 3 calendar days of receipt

• Receiving commander must notify General Court Marshall Convening Authority (GCMCA) using the chain of command within 72 hours and must be documented on MFO

Page 33: Military  EO Compliant Processing

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

33

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GDEPLOYED - Formal Complaint Processing

APPEALING THE COMPLAINT

• Soldiers have 7 calendars days from the date of notification of the results of the investigation and acknowledgment of the actions of the command to resolve the complaint to submit an appeal

• Appeals must be in writing and provide a brief statement that identifies the basis of the appeal. This will be done using Part IV, DA Form 7279-R (EO Complaint Form). After completion of the form it will be returned to the commander in the chain of command

• Once an appeal has been initiated, the commander has 3 calendar days to refer the appeal to the next higher commander.

Page 34: Military  EO Compliant Processing

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

34

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GDEPLOYED - Formal Complaint Processing

APPEALING THE COMPLAINT (con’t)

• The commander of the next higher command will have 14 calendar days to consider the appeal. Actions on the appeal will be to approve it, deny the appeal, or order an additional investigation. The commander acting on the appeal must provide written feedback to the complainant within 14 calendar days of the results

• Should the soldier wish to pursue the appeal to a higher authority, the General Courts-martial Convening Authority (normally the first General Officer in the chain of command) will have “final decision authority.” No further appeals are available within the EO complaint system.

Page 35: Military  EO Compliant Processing

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

UNCLASSIFIED / FOUO

35

MILITARY EO COMPLAINT PROCESSINGDEPLOYED - Formal Complaint Processing

FOLLOW-UP ASSESSMENT

• The EOA will conduct a follow-up assessment of all formal EO complaints, for both substantiated and unsubstantiated complaints, 30 to 45 days following the decision rendered on the complaint

–Purpose is to measure the effectiveness of the actions taken and to detect and deter any acts or threats of reprisal or harassment

• The EOA will conduct a second assessment 180 days following the final decision rendered on the complaint

–The EOA will assess the complainant’s satisfaction of the process to include timeliness, staff responsiveness, and helpfulness, and the resolution of the complaint.
